While you're working on a project, playback includes an audio watermark, a short spoken tag such as "subscribe to Cryo Mix" or "mixed by Cryo Mix" layered into the sound. If you're hearing a voice between or over your music, that's what it is, not a glitch in your track.

Why is the watermark there?

It protects work made during the free preview stage, before a subscription is active. It's only applied to previews.

How do I remove it?

Any paid subscription removes the watermark. Once you subscribe, Cryo Mix detects your active plan and lets you reprocess your tracks to produce a clean version without the audio tag.

Can I hear a clean version before subscribing?

Not currently. Previews always include the watermark until you have an active subscription. There's no watermark-free preview on the free plan.
